  • Rated 1 out of 5 stars

    not worth it

    Posted .
    This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.

    This seemed like an easy way to mount the camera on anything in order to get closeup pictures of my wife and I while on vacation. I'm just glad I opened it up before going on the trip. The legs are very awkward to move and unstable. The connection where the camera mounts to the tripod is unstable. I wouldn't trust this tripod if I had a disposable camera, much less a brand new point and shoot. I wanted it so I could mount the tripod on objects - this is only functional when left on the ground...at twice the price of a conventional tripod that would fit my needs.
